Aus dem Text: „Die Zahl der eingeleiteten Straf- und Bußgeldverfahren gegen Hartz-IV-Empfänger ist im vergangenen Jahr um 1,8 Prozent auf knapp
165.000 Fälle gestiegen. Dies geht aus der Jahresbilanz der Bundesagentur für Arbeit (BA) über den Leistungsmissbrauch im Hartz-IV-System hervor, die der Süddeutschen Zeitung vorliegt. Dabei geht es meist um falsche Angaben von Langzeitarbeitslosen gegenüber den Jobcentern und Arbeitsgemeinschaften (Argen) mit dem Ziel, höhere Leistungen zu kassieren, als ihnen eigentlich zustehen. (…) Insgesamt hatten 2009 im Jahresdurchschnitt etwa 6,5 Millionen Menschen nach dem Sozialgesetzbuch II Anspruch auf die Grundsicherung (Hartz IV). Bezogen auf diese Gesamtzahl lag die Missbrauchsquote nach Angaben der Bundesagentur bei lediglich bei 1,9 Prozent. Darunter fallen Ordnungswidrigkeiten, also geringfügige Verletzungen von Rechtsregeln, für die das Gesetz eine Geldbuße vorsieht…“

Civis Romanus Sum

AntiWar.Com
by Philip Giraldi

02/13/10

Obama’s decision to assassinate Americans overseas without any due process might well be viewed as an inevitable development from the established practice of killing foreigners using hellfire missiles fired from unmanned drones in places like Afghanistan, Pakistan, Yemen, and Somalia. The United States has not declared war on any of those countries yet it reserves to itself the right to attack and kill local residents based on information that it does not subsequently have to reveal. This process is given a legal fig leaf by the US assertion that anyone connected to a terrorist group can be killed anywhere in the world and at any time. It assumes that in such matters the United States has extraterritorial jurisdiction, a claim that no other nation makes and which might reasonably be contested by those on the receiving end. It also does not require the President of the United States to prove his case that someone actually was a terrorist...

--------

The US can no longer afford its empire

Independent Institute
by Ivan Eland

02/03/10

President Obama has presented Congress with a spending request of $3.8 trillion for the next fiscal year in 2011, but with a third of it not paid for with taxes, thus resulting in a $1.3 trillion deficit (a whopping 8.3 percent of GDP). The small piece of good news is that this deficit is smaller as a portion of the nation’s economic output than this year’s gargantuan 10.6 percent for FY 2010 (that $1.6 trillion deficit is a post-World War II record). Budget deficits of this magnitude have occurred before, but only during cataclysmic wars — the Civil War and World Wars I and II. Contrary to the rhetoric of congressional Republicans, who are stridently criticizing Obama for his excessive spending, these budget deficits are largely the result of George W. Bush’s new entitlement program (Medicare prescription drug coverage), the usual Republican fake tax cuts (tax cuts without concomitant reductions in government spending), bank and insurance bailouts, and the conduct of two disastrous U.S. occupations of foreign countries. Of course, Obama is far from blameless...
